Why Playing Roblox on a School Chromebook Is Possible in 2026
The Evolution of Browser-Based Cloud Gaming
Cloud gaming has completely changed how games are played on restricted devices. Instead of running the game on your Chromebook, the game runs on powerful remote servers and streams to your browser. Because ChromeOS only has to display the stream and send your inputs, even basic school-issued Chromebooks can handle Roblox without problems.
